Machine-generated summaryRSPB Scotland procured peatland restoration works on 213 hectares within the RSPB Oa nature reserve on Islay. The aim was to repair damage and restore blanket bog functionality. Activities included gully and drain blocking using peat and plastic, and reprofiling. Contractors had to attend a compulsory site visit on 12th August 2026 from 10am to 3pm, starting from the Oa Monument visitors car park, with up to 1km of walking over rough ground, and confirm attendance to Toni Bradley by 29th July 2026.
